The Essential Role of a Cyber Protection Strategist
In the evolving landscape of digital threats, the role of a Cyber Protection Strategist has become increasingly vital for organizations. This specialist conducts comprehensive cyber risk assessments to identify vulnerabilities, ensuring robust defenses.
Furthermore, they develop and implement incident response strategies, enabling organizations to swiftly mitigate breaches. By prioritizing proactive measures, Cyber Protection Strategists empower entities to safeguard their digital assets and maintain operational integrity.
Key Challenges in Cybersecurity Today
While organizations strive to enhance their cybersecurity measures, they face an array of complex challenges that undermine their efforts.
Phishing attacks continue to evolve, exploiting human vulnerabilities, while ransomware threats escalate, paralyzing operations and demanding exorbitant ransoms.
These pervasive issues highlight the need for robust security frameworks and continuous employee training to safeguard sensitive data and maintain organizational integrity in an increasingly hostile digital landscape.
Innovative Strategies for Cyber Defense
Organizations must adopt innovative strategies for cyber defense to effectively combat the evolving landscape of cyber threats.
Emphasizing proactive measures, they should implement robust risk assessments that identify vulnerabilities and potential attack vectors.
Leveraging advanced technologies like AI and machine learning enhances threat detection capabilities.
Additionally, fostering a culture of cybersecurity awareness empowers employees to act as the first line of defense against cyber intrusions.
